UK Status
Resident. Locally common throughout mainland Britain.
Montgomeryshire Status
Recorded from a handful of sites in the western side of the county. Last seen at Lake Vyrnwy in 2007.
Wingspan
:
M & F, 7-9mm.
Confusion species
This species is not easily distinguished from others. A good way of separating it is to examine the leaf-mine in the foodplant.

Habitat
Birch scrub.
Foodplant
Birch.
Lifestage data
Leaf miner. Eggs are laid near the tip of the leaf. Larva forms a
straight gallery which expands abruptly into an elongated blotch.
(Mines of some species are similar, care is required with
identification). |
